The core principles of Pilates provide numerous health benefits, promoting physical fitness and overall wellness. Firstly, Pilates emphasizes alignment and posture, critical elements for bodily health. Proper alignment not only enhances strength but also reduces the risk of injury. This increased stability allows individuals to engage in more demanding physical activities with confidence, contributing to a more active lifestyle. Secondly, the mindful breathing techniques incorporated in Pilates serve to promote relaxation. Inhale more deeply engages muscles, while exhaling relieves tension. These breathing methods promote oxygen flow to vital organs, aiding the detoxification process. Furthermore, Pilates effectively targets the deep abdominal muscles, which are essential for core stability. Strengthening this area supports better posture, thus improving overall body mechanics and efficiency. Moreover, the movements in Pilates encourage flexibility and joint mobility, further enhancing bodily function. Improved flexibility supports a wider range of motion, reducing stiffness and discomfort in everyday activities. Practicing Pilates regularly can also enhance muscle tone without the bulk, creating a long, lean physique. By fostering a strong mind-body connection, Pilates helps individuals become more in tune with their bodies, encouraging self-awareness in fitness routines.

Incorporating mindful nutrition alongside Pilates practice can elevate detoxification benefits. Nutrition plays a vital role in supporting the cleansing of the body. A di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ins can enhance the detox process. Specifically, foods high in fiber assist in eliminating waste and promoting digestive health. Moreover, incorporating antioxidant-rich foods can help combat oxidative stress, further supporting detoxification and cellular repair.
